To remove this trust gap, the server sends a chain of certificates from the server CA through any intermediates to a SCEP profiles dont support dynamic challenges. Many web sites describe a poor alternative solution, which is to install a Problem: English. Also, be aware that HostnameVerifier.verify() In rare cases, CAs are either tricked or, in the case of Comodo or DigiNotar, breached, You are using an out of date browser. Android How to stop EditText from gaining focus when an activity starts in Android? Unfortunately, occasionally these Click, Enter your service account credentials and click. Download and install the installation file, configuration file, and key file on one computer as described in the following steps.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Export your CA certificate and convert it to a PEM file by running the following commands: Import the CA certificate to the keystore. Making statements based on opinion; back them up with references or personal experience. WebTap Install a certificate Wi-Fi certificate. Did the drapes in old theatres actually say "ASBESTOS" on them? provides pinning with these capabilities. Doing this leaves your users vulnerable to attacks when using a public Wi-Fi hotspot, because an supports the notion of client certificates that let the server validate the identity of a a server certificate using its private key. As a developer, you may want to know what certificates are trusted on Android for compatibility, testing, and device security. Proper use cases for Android UserManager.isUserAGoat()? On Android devices running Android 9.x or below, the app will automatically install the Xfinity WiFi secure profile to help your device connect to secure Xfinity WiFi Hotspots where available. Note: You download the Google Cloud Certificate Connector and its components only once, when you first set up certificates for your organization. The profile includes the Certificate Authority that issues device certificates. While beyond the scope of this article, the techniques involved are similar to specifying For example, an email app might use TLS variants Go to www.xfinity.com/wifi. any device you use to connect to the internet. In Android 10 and higher, TLS 1.3 is enabled by default for all TLS connections. For Chrome OS devices, you can set up user-based or device-based certificates. Unfortunately, I have yet to find a way to install a CA Certificate programmatically - from within the app.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ey. You assign device certificates to devices and users with SCEP Profiles. Wifi Password (ROOT) 8.4 17 Reviews. different solutions.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Hi Nikolay , I read your Keystore post here :-. Caution: On Android devices, the certificate is automatically selected and the user clicks Connect. To trust custom CAs without needing to change your app's code, change your s_client command, passing in the port number.